sql拆解字串

相關問題 & 資訊整理

sql拆解字串

要如何在SQL Server 中實作字串分割(類似C# 字串的 Split 方法) 呢?在SQL Server 中,並沒有直接提供字串分割的函式。因此要藉由複雜一點的方法來達成:. 先轉成XML ... ,2020年3月16日 — 7. 最後,再利用函數 substr 與 instr 搭配: select b.*, substr(b.column_b, -- 取值的字串來源 instr(b.column_b, ',', 1, c.lv) + 1, -- 從那開始 ... ,SQL Server TSQL 開發技巧- 將資料庫的字串分解後_直接轉換成欄位- PIVOT 與SPLIT - tsql_pivot_split ... -解法,利用傳統函數將字串分解,並且搭配NEWID讓每一組字串有獨立 ... ,2023年1月24日 — 分割為左右兩欄,並取得右(左) 方的資料 · CHARINDEX 找到逗號所在的位置。 · LEN 取得字串長度。 · 再使用 SUBSTRING 擷取逗號後面~ 字串結尾的字為子字串。 ,2023年11月15日 — STRING_SPLIT 是數據表值函式,會根據指定的分隔符,將字串分割成子字串的數據列。 相容性層級130. STRING_SPLIT 需要相容性層級至少為130。 當層級小於130 ... ,2024年7月5日 — SUBSTRING 函式的Transact-SQL 參考。 此函式會傳回部分指定字元、二進位、文字或影像運算式。 ,C# 有split功能,那sql sever呢? 方法1. --STRING_SPLIT 需要為至少130 的相容性層級。,2018年9月7日 — 在這篇文章[SQL] 特定符號隔離字串資料 內是利用CTE 來拆解資料,SQL Server 2016 新函數- STRING_SPLIT() 可以更快速、簡潔達到相同效果 ,中發現STRING_SPLIT() 的分隔符只支援「1個字元」的狀況。因此,應對這個情境,我們可以使用REPLACE() 先將分隔符取代成單一字元的符號(建議可以使用控制字 ...,2016年3月9日 — 不過,每個做法總有黑暗面,當複合代碼字串要拿來查資料時,得先拆解成OrgId、DeptId、UserId三個值,在C#裡用個.Split('-')可以輕鬆搞定,但如果要在SQL裡處理 ...

相關軟體 Oracle Database Express 資訊

Oracle Database Express
Oracle Database Express 版(Oracle 數據庫 XE)是基於 Oracle 數據庫 11g 第 2 版代碼庫的入門級小型數據庫。開發,部署和分發是免費的; 快速下載; 並且管理簡單. 選擇版本:Oracle Database Express 版本 11g 第 2 版(32 位)Oracle Database Express 版本 11g 第 2 版(64 位) Oracle Database Express 軟體介紹

sql拆解字串 相關參考資料
Day 24: SQL Server 的字串分割 - iT 邦幫忙

要如何在SQL Server 中實作字串分割(類似C# 字串的 Split 方法) 呢?在SQL Server 中,並沒有直接提供字串分割的函式。因此要藉由複雜一點的方法來達成:. 先轉成XML ...

https://ithelp.ithome.com.tw

Oracle_將一欄內的多筆資料拆解

2020年3月16日 — 7. 最後,再利用函數 substr 與 instr 搭配: select b.*, substr(b.column_b, -- 取值的字串來源 instr(b.column_b, ',', 1, c.lv) + 1, -- 從那開始 ...

https://hackmd.io

SQL Server TSQL 開發技巧- 將資料庫的字串分解後

SQL Server TSQL 開發技巧- 將資料庫的字串分解後_直接轉換成欄位- PIVOT 與SPLIT - tsql_pivot_split ... -解法,利用傳統函數將字串分解,並且搭配NEWID讓每一組字串有獨立 ...

https://gist.github.com

SQL Server 的字串分割

2023年1月24日 — 分割為左右兩欄,並取得右(左) 方的資料 · CHARINDEX 找到逗號所在的位置。 · LEN 取得字串長度。 · 再使用 SUBSTRING 擷取逗號後面~ 字串結尾的字為子字串。

https://b6land.github.io

STRING_SPLIT (Transact-SQL) - SQL Server

2023年11月15日 — STRING_SPLIT 是數據表值函式,會根據指定的分隔符,將字串分割成子字串的數據列。 相容性層級130. STRING_SPLIT 需要相容性層級至少為130。 當層級小於130 ...

https://learn.microsoft.com

SUBSTRING (Transact-SQL) - SQL Server

2024年7月5日 — SUBSTRING 函式的Transact-SQL 參考。 此函式會傳回部分指定字元、二進位、文字或影像運算式。

https://learn.microsoft.com

[SQL] split 切割字串 - iT 邦幫忙

C# 有split功能,那sql sever呢? 方法1. --STRING_SPLIT 需要為至少130 的相容性層級。

https://ithelp.ithome.com.tw

[SQL] 利用STRING_SPLIT() 拆解特定符號隔離字串資料

2018年9月7日 — 在這篇文章[SQL] 特定符號隔離字串資料 內是利用CTE 來拆解資料,SQL Server 2016 新函數- STRING_SPLIT() 可以更快速、簡潔達到相同效果

https://jengting.blogspot.com

[TSQL] 在MSSQL中使用STRING_SPLIT()函式分隔「多字元」 ...

中發現STRING_SPLIT() 的分隔符只支援「1個字元」的狀況。因此,應對這個情境,我們可以使用REPLACE() 先將分隔符取代成單一字元的符號(建議可以使用控制字 ...

https://medium.com

將複合字串拆成多欄位-以ORACLE及SQL為例

2016年3月9日 — 不過,每個做法總有黑暗面,當複合代碼字串要拿來查資料時,得先拆解成OrgId、DeptId、UserId三個值,在C#裡用個.Split('-')可以輕鬆搞定,但如果要在SQL裡處理 ...

https://blog.darkthread.net